Mitec selling VSAT gear in Africa

Brief | March 5, 2008

Mitec Telecom Inc. has received a second order for its VSAT equipment from a major cellular network operator in Africa. In January, Mitec started delivering gear to this operator, but this second order reinforces the company’s position as a leading provider of 2-way satellite communications for growth markets. The Montreal-based firm has now kicked off discussions with the customer about selling it traditional mobile wireless infrastructure equipment.
